those $40 martin strings are very interesting. when you strum chords they are very close to being as warm as phosphor bronze, when you pick the low strings the bass is more defined as it has a bit more low mids i think, and the B and E strings are stainless so they get more high mids and presence which help them cut through on leads and sound louder. which also has the effect of making your sus and 7 chords really pop since the higher notes have more presence. they also have about 50% more sustain than phosphor bronze which is really cool at the cost of a slight amount of actual volume, which shouldn't really be a problem since you're gaining some mids. if these last as long as they say i'll keep being them, great for martins since they're naturally very lacking in treble.

>>127944420>>127944424they bought bourgeois, and make the bourgeois touchstone guitars. dana bourgeois voices the tops and ships them to eastman and they build the rest. they no longer use name brand tuners or nitro finish on any of their instruments and they have adopted the bright bourgeois tone in their acoustic guitars. these things may sound inconsequential but 1) why the fuck would you pay $1000+ for a chinese guitar and not get good tuners and 2) it's evident of a paradigm shift in the company. it's a downward trend that could very well get worse over time. you might find some good models here and they but i wouldn't expect every eastman to be as good as they have been before the acquisition

>what kind of pickup do you prefer?My preference for single-coil pickups stems from their distinctive tonal qualities—clarity, brightness, and articulation—that resonate deeply with my musical sensibilities. Unlike humbuckers, which offer thicker, more homogenized sound, single-coils produce a shimmering, transparent tone that allows every nuance of my playing to shine through. This crystalline quality lends itself well to genres like blues, funk, and classic rock, where precision and expressiveness are paramount. Additionally, single-coil pickups are highly responsive—they pick up subtle variations in string vibrations and dynamics, fostering a more intimate and interactive relationship between player and instrument. This responsiveness encourages a nuanced, conversational approach, making each note and vibrato feel purposeful and emotionally charged. Culturally, iconic artists such as Jimi Hendrix and Buddy Holly exemplify the expressive potential of single-coils. Their bright, bell-like tones evoke nostalgia while maintaining timeless appeal. Although the susceptibility to electromagnetic hum can be a drawback, I see this as a manageable trade-off for the sonic clarity and expressive versatility they provide. Ultimately, my affinity for single-coil pickups lies in their ability to deliver articulate, responsive, and emotionally evocative sounds. They invite a more nuanced interaction with the instrument—qualities that transcend technical specs and tap into the very soul of electric guitar playing.
